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p is ready to usher in a massive clearout at the club this summer.

The Reds did not put up a very good defense of their Premier League title, finishing 3rd in the league and 17 points behind champions Manchester City.

Per the Daily Star, there are nine players who could make way this summer as Klopp refreshes his squad with a view to challenging for elite honors again.

Goalkeeper Adrian, defender Ben Davies, youngster Neco Williams, midfielder Xherdan Shaqiri, striker Divock Origi, shot stopper Loris Karius and midfielders Harry Wilson and Marko Grujic could all depart.

One who is all but certain to leave is Gini Wijnaldum, who will be out of contract.
